This is a horror book about a group of hired guns who are hired to help a woman find her nephew at a religious compound called Little Heaven. During their investigation the group finds something more sinister is lurking in the woods around the compound. I really enjoyed this book. While it wasn't necessarily scary to me, there was a lot of creepy and disturbing imagery and the story was very intriguing, which made me want to keep reading. (4/5)

#TBRtemptation post 8! Cutter is known for intense, gory horror that leaves you going ?? after the end. This is described as reminiscent of Cormac McCarthy's "Blood Meridian" and Stephen King's "It". A woman hires a trio of mercenaries to check in on her nephew, who was taken to a remote New Mexican settlement. The Black Rock monolith overlooks the place as things spiral out of control.
